Select Brand:

Show All


£26.94

Dispatch on next business day

£5.92

Dispatch on next business day

£3.03

Dispatch on next business day

£5.46

Dispatch on next business day

£4.88

Dispatch on next business day

£6.34

Dispatch on next business day

£4.03

Dispatch on next business day

£13.80

Dispatch on next business day

£29.47

Dispatch on next business day

£3.96

Dispatch on next business day

£5.30

Dispatch on next business day

£5.80

Dispatch on next business day